INTRODUCTION: Shoulder pain after stroke, a complication with a prevalence of up to 16­84% usually occurs after 2­3 months and leads to patients withdrawing from rehabilitation programs, staying in the hospital longer, having less limb function and having a great negative impact on their quality of life. The aim of the present study was to determine the effect of PEMF and NMES in reducing shoulder pain in patients with stroke. MATERIAL AND METHODS: A prospective, randomized controlled trial included 51 patients with shoulder pain following stroke. The patients were randomly assigned to three groups (17 people in each group): Pulsed Electromagnetic Field (PEMF), Neuromuscular Electrical Stimulation (NMES) and Control group. The outcome measures were Visual Analogue Scale (VAS), Modified Ashworth Scale (MAS) and Fugl Meyer Assessment­Upper Extremity (FMA-UE), Active and Passive Range of Motion (AROM/PROM) assessed at the baseline, six weeks into the intervention, and one week into the follow-up. RESULTS: VAS score for pain showed a mean change of 1.60, 1.60 and 4.94 in PEMF, NMES, and control respectively after 20 sessions. It showed pain was significantly improved in all the groups (p<0.001), but the effectiveness of the PEMF and NMES groups was superior to the control group. CONCLUSION: The current literature showed that PEMF & NMES are effective in improving post-stroke shoulder pain, spasticity, range of motion and motor function and a novel method for stroke patients undergoing rehabilitation.

Purpose: This randomized, controlled, blinded study evaluates the efficacy of intense pulsed light (IPL) therapy with low?level light therapy (LLLT) in the treatment of meibomian gland dysfunction (MGD) and evaporative dry eye (EDE) compared to a control group. Methods: Hundred patients with MGD and EDE were randomized into control (50 subjects, 100 eyes) and study group (50 subjects, 100 eyes). The study group underwent three sittings of IPL with LLLT 15 days apart and were followed up 1 month and 2 months after the last treatment sitting. The control group underwent sham treatment and was followed up at the same intervals. The patients were evaluated at baseline and 1 month and 3 months (post 1st treatment) for dry eye. Schirmer's test and tear breakup time (TBUT), OSDI, meibomian gland expression, and meibography. Results: The study group showed significant improvement in OSDI scores (P < 0.0001) compared to the control group and a significant improvement in TBUT (P < 0.005) compared to the control group. There was no change in schirmer's test and an improvement in the meibomian gland expression but not significant. Conclusion: The results show that a combined therapy of IPL with LLT is effective in treating MGD with EDE compared to controls, and repeated treatment sessions have a cumulative effect on the disease outcomes

This study reviewed the efficacy and safety of intense pulsed light (IPL) for the treatment of dry eye disease (DED). The PubMed database was used to conduct the literature search, which used the keywords “intense pulsed light” and “dry eye disease”. After the authors evaluated the articles for relevancy, 49 articles were reviewed. In general, all treatment modalities were proven to be clinically effective in reducing dry eye (DE) signs and symptoms; however, the level of improvement and persistence of outcomes differed amongst them. Meta-analysis indicated significant improvement in the Ocular Surface Disease Index (OSDI) scores post-treatment with a standardized mean difference (SMD) = ?1.63; confidence interval (CI): ?2.42 to ?0.84. Moreover, a meta-analysis indicated a significant improvement in tear break-up time (TBUT) test values with SMD = 1.77; CI: 0.49 to 3.05. Research suggests that additive therapies, such as meibomian gland expression (MGX), sodium hyaluronate eye drops, heated eye mask, warm compress, lid hygiene, lid margin scrub, eyelid massage, antibiotic drops, cyclosporine drops, omega-3 supplements, steroid drops, and warm compresses along with IPL, have been found to work in tandem for greater effectiveness; however, in clinical practice, its feasibility and cost-effectiveness have to be taken into consideration. Current findings suggest that IPL therapy is suitable when lifestyle modifications such as reducing or eliminating the use of contact lenses, lubricating eye drops/gels, and warm compresses/eye masks fail to improve signs and symptoms of DE. Moreover, patients with compliance issues have been shown to benefit well as the effects of IPL therapy is sustained for over several months. DED is a multifactorial disorder, and IPL therapy has been found to be safe and efficient in reducing its signs and symptoms of meibomian gland dysfunction (MGD)-related DE. Although the treatment protocol varies among authors, current findings suggest that IPL has a positive effect on the signs and symptoms of MGD-related DE. However, patients in the early stages can benefit more from IPL therapy. Moreover, IPL has a better maintenance impact when used in conjunction with other traditional therapies. Further research is needed to assess cost-utility analysis for IPL.

AIM: To observe the therapeutic effect of the diquafosol sodium combined with intense pulsed light(IPL)on meibomian gland dysfunction(MGD)dry eye after refractive surgery.METHODS:A total of 64 patients(128 eyes)with MGD dry eye diagnosed within 6mo after laser corneal refractive surgery in our hospital from March 2021 to December 2021 were selected. They were randomly divided into control group and experimental group. A total of 33 patients(66 eyes)in the control group were treated with sodium hyaluronate combined with IPL, and 31 patients(62 eyes)in the experimental group were treated with diquafosol sodium combined with IPL. Ocular symptom scores were performed before each IPL treatment in both groups to examine non-invasive tear breakup time(NIBUT), tear meniscus height, lipid layer grade of tear film, meibomian gland deletion rate and uncorrected visual acuity.RESULTS:After IPL treatment, ocular symptom scores and meibomian gland deletion rate score of two groups were decreased continuously. NIBUT, tear meniscus height and lipid layer grade of tear film were increased continuously, and there was no significant change in uncorrected visual acuity. NIBUT of patients in the experimental group was better than that in the control group before the third IPL treatment(6.24±0.27s vs. 5.51±0.24s, P=0.046).CONCLUSIONS:Both diquafosol sodium and sodium hyaluronate combined with IPL showed good therapeutic effect on MGD dry eye, but there was no significant difference in the short-term efficacy between the two groups.

Objective:To investigate the practical efficacy of low-intensity pulsed ultrasound(LIPUS)and its effects on hemodynamics in patients with coronary heart disease and angina pectoris.Methods:As a single-center randomized controlled study, 66 elderly patients with coronary heart disease and angina pectoris treated at Qilu Hospital of Shandong University between November 2021 and August 2022 were consecutively recruited.Participants were divided into an ultrasound group and a control group via the random number table method, with 33 in each group.Both groups were given conventional drug treatment, and the ultrasound group was supplemented with LIPUS treatment.After 20 sessions of treatment, the clinical efficacy, blood lipid levels, inflammatory factors and hemodynamics from noninvasive monitoring before and after treatment were compared.Results:There were no statistically significant differences in baseline data between the two groups( P>0.05). After treatment, marked effectiveness was seen in 12 cases(36.4%), effectiveness in 18 cases(54.5%), ineffectiveness in 2 cases(6.1%)and aggravation in 1 case(3%)in the ultrasound group, with a total effectiveness rate of 90.9 %.In the control group, marked effectiveness was seen 2 cases(6.1%), effectiveness in 19 cases(57.6%)and ineffectiveness in 9 cases(27.3%), with a total effectiveness rate of 63.6%.Statistically significant favorable results were achieved in the ultrasound treatment group, compared with the control group( P<0.05). Also, compared with the control group, patients in the ultrasound group showed lower total cholesterol[(2.31±1.03)mmol/L vs.(4.36±0.76)mmol/L, P<0.01], decreased low-density lipoprotein cholesterol[(1.24±0.70)mmol/L vs.(1.74±0.44)mmol/L, P<0.01], decreased triglycerides[(1.04±0.40)mmol/L vs.(1.28±0.49)mmol/L, P<0.05], decreased apolipoprotein B[(0.67±0.25)g/L vs.(0.90±0.14)g/L, P<0.01], decreased interleukin-6[(2.87±2.52)ng/L vs.(4.66±3.30)ng/L, P<0.05], and decreased high-sensitivity C-reactive protein[(1.04±1.41)mg/L vs.(3.80±5.78)mg/L, P<0.05]. Concerning hemodynamics, there was an increase in cardiac output[(4.92±1.05)L/min vs.(4.39±0.97)L/min, P<0.05], stroke volume[(75.85±17.50)ml/beat vs.(66.97±15.57)ml/beat, P<0.05], cardiac index[(37.50±7.14)ml·beat -1·m -2vs.(43.29±7.96)ml·beat -1·m -2, P<0.01], and stroke volume index[(3.05±0.45)L/min 2vs.(2.51±0.43)L/min 2, P<0.01], but a decrease in systemic vascular resistance[(1 358.29±325.23)dyne·s -1·cm -5vs.(1 617.94±526.27)dyne·s -1·cm -5, P<0.05], total vascular resistance[(4.07±24.30)% vs.(21.32±31.94)%, P<0.05], and average heart rate[(63.43±7.42)beats/min vs.(69.11±10.89)beats/min, P<0.05]. Conclusions:LIPUS treatment can improve symptoms, blood lipid profiles, inflammatory factors and hemodynamics in patients with coronary heart disease and angina pectoris.It is a safe and effective adjuvant therapy for elderly patients with coronary heart disease and angina pectoris.

Objective:To identify the cause of a suspected foodborne disease caused by bacterial food poisoning using multiple detection methods.Methods:At 9:35 a.m. on August 9, 2022, a suspected foodborne disease incident was handled by the Hefei Center for Disease Control and Prevention. The preliminary laboratory test results showed that the foodborne disease was caused by Staphylococcus aureus infection. Sixteen strains of Staphylococcus aureus were isolated, cultured, and identified using real-time fluorescent polymerase chain reaction. At the same time, the 16 strains of Staphylococcus aureus isolated from different sources were analyzed by pulsed-field gel electrophoresis to determine the correlation between strains. Results:The distribution of 16 strains of Staphylococcus aureus enterotoxins isolated was that the anal swab and chopping board (inner) smear samples from a salesperson surnamed Li showed SEB type, and the remaining 14 strains all carried type A, C, and E enterotoxin genes simultaneously. Pulsed-field gel electrophoresis typing results showed that there were two types of strains; except the anal swab and chopping board (inner) smear samples from the salesperson surnamed Li, the other 14 strains were all of the same type, with a similarity of 100%. The similarity between the anal swab and the chopping board (inner) smear samples from the salesperson surnamed Li was 80.65%, and the similarity with another type was 59.26%. This result was consistent with the detection results of Staphylococcus aureus enterotoxins. Conclusion:The foodborne disease in this case was caused by mixed contamination of two or three different sources of Staphylococcus aureus with enterotoxins.

Objective:To analyze the efficacy and safety of ultrasound-guided intercostal nerve pulse radiofrequency combined with nerve block in the treatment of post-herpetic neuralgia.Methods:The clinical data of 62 patients with post-herpetic neuralgia who received treatment in The Affiliated Hospital of Southwest Medical University from May 2017 to May 2021 were retrospectively analyzed. These patients underwent nerve block (NB group, n = 30) or pulsed radiofrequency plus nerve block (PRF + NB group, n = 32). Before and after treatment, The Numerical Rating Scale (NRS) score and Pittsburgh Sleep Quality Index (PSQI) score were compared between the two groups. After treatment, the occurrence of complications including pneumothorax, infection, and skin numbness was evaluated in each group. Results:Before treatment, there were no significant differences in NRS and PSQI scores between the two groups (all P > 0.05). Immediately, 1 week and 1 month after treatment, there was no significant difference in PSQI score between the two groups (all P > 0.05). At 3 and 6 months after treatment, the NRS score in the NB +PRF group was (1.71 ± 0.35) points and (1.68 ± 0.36) points, which were significantly lower than (2.72 ± 0.68) points and (3.26 ± 0.76) points in the NB group ( t = 54.40, 78.18, both P < 0.05). There were no treatment-related complications such as pneumothorax, infection, nerve numbness, or muscle weakness in the two groups. Conclusion:Ultrasound-guided pulsed radiofrequency combined with nerve block has a definite curative effect on post-herpetic neuralgia and is highly safe. The medium- and long-term efficacy of the combined therapy is superior to that of nerve block alone.

Objective:To explore the methods to improve the success rate of external canal foreign body washing and reduce the incidence of adverse reaction in children (≤14 years old).Methods:This study was a randomized controlled trial. A total of 60 pediatric patients with ear canal foreign bodies who were admitted to the otolaryngology-head and neck surgery clinic of Shengjing Hospital Affiliated to China Medical University from January 2021 to May 2022 were selected. The patients were divided into the experimental group and the control group by the random number table method, with 30 cases in each group. The experimental group were treated with pulsatile external auditory canal irrigation method, while the control group were treated with the conventional ear canal flushing method. The success rate of flushing, the flushing time, the incidence of adverse reactions and satisfaction of the patient's family were compared between the two groups.Results:The success rate of flushing was 80.0% (24/30) in the experimental group and 46.7% (14/30) in the control group, with statistically significant difference ( χ2= 7.18, P <0.05). The flushing time was (140.80 ± 44.48) s in the experimental group and (296.60 ± 82.79) s in the control group, with statistically significant difference ( t=9.08, P <0.05). The incidence of adverse reactions was 23.3% (7/30) in the experimental group and 63.3% (19/30) in the control group, with statistically significant difference ( χ2=9.77, P<0.05). The satisfaction of the patient's family was 93.9% (28/30) in the experimental group and 36.7% (11/30) in the control group, with statistically significant difference ( χ2=21.17, P<0.05). Conclusions:The pulsatile external auditory canal irrigation method can improve the success rate of ear canal foreign body flushing, shorten the flushing time and reduce the adverse reactions. The need for surgery and hospitalization due to ear canal foreign body, the suffering of patients and the corresponding cost can be decreased accordingly. The new treatment showed clear advantages clinically and should be widely applied.

AIM:To investigate the effect of 3% diquafosol sodium eye drops combined with intense pulsed light on the treatment of meibomian gland dysfunction and the change of meibomian glands.METHODS: Prospective study. A total of 141 patients(282 eyes)who were diagnosed with meibomian gland dysfunction from January 2021 to May 2022 in our hospital were selected and they were randomly divided into the control group(73 cases, 146 eyes)and the observation group(68 cases, 136 eyes)according to random number table. The control group was given 0.3% sodium hyaluronate eye drops combined with intense pulsed light, and the observation group was treated with 3% diquafosol sodium eye drops combined with intense pulsed light. The subjective symptom score, physical sign score, non-invasive tear break-up time, tear meniscus height, lipid layer thickness, and meibomian gland density before and after the treatment were compared between the two groups at 2wk after the end of treatment.RESULTS: There were no differences in the subjective symptom score, physical sign score, non-invasive tear break-up time, tear meniscus height, lipid layer thickness, and meibomian gland density between the two groups of patients before treatment(P&#x003E;0.05). After 2wk of treatment, the symptom scores and physical sign scores of patients in the two groups continued to decrease, non-invasive tear break-up time and lipid layer thickness continued to increase, and the meibomian gland density also increased. The tear meniscus height in the observation group increased, while the control group showed no significant changes. The observation group had better clinical indicators than the control group(P&#x003C;0.05). No obvious complications were observed in all patients.CONCLUSION: The combination of diquafosol sodium eye drops and intense pulsed light is synergistic in the treatment of meibomian gland dysfunction, with significant therapeutic effects and improvement of meibomian gland repair, which is significantly superior to simple intense pulsed light therapy.

OBJECTIVE@#To evaluate the effect of intense pulsed light (IPL) in the treatment of chronic hordeolum.@*METHODS@#Patients with chronic hordeolum who underwent IPL treatment were enrolled in this study. According to the severity of hordeolum, the patients were treated with IPL 3 to 5 times. Patients' satisfaction and visual analog scale scores for ocular discomfort symptoms before and after treatment were collected. The number, congestion, long diameter, short diameter and area of nodules were also recorded and measured. Finally, eyelid margin signs, meibum quality, meibomian gland expressibility, meibomian gland dropout, tear meniscus height, and corneal fluorescein staining were scored.@*RESULTS@#20 patients were enrolled in this study. The eyelid margins were congestive and swollen, with blunt rounding or irregularity. The meibum was cloudy or toothpaste-like. The meibomian gland expressibility, meibomian gland dropout and tear meniscus height were reduced. The cornea showed scattered fluorescein staining. After treatment, score of visual analog scale, congestion and size of nodules were significantly reduced. Eyelid margin signs, meibum quality, meibomian gland expressibility, tear meniscus height and corneal fluorescein staining scores were improved. Meibomian gland dropout had no significant change. No side effects occurred during treatment.@*CONCLUSIONS@#IPL is beneficial for the treatment of chronic hordeolum.

【Objective】 The thermal effects of super-pulsed thulium fiber laser (TFL) at different powers,lithotripsy modes and irrigation rates were studied using a 3D kidney model to simulate ureteral lithotripsy in vivo. 【Methods】 A thermal effect model was established in vitro. Under the same conditions of laboratory temperature and equipment,the temperature around the optical fiber was measured and compared when different optical fiber diameters,powers,lithotripsy modes and irrigation rates were used to simulate lithotripsy by TFL. 【Results】 There was significant difference in the temperature around the optical fiber caused by two fibers with different diameters under the same conditions (P<0.05). Under the same conditions,different lithotripsic modes produced different temperatures,and the temperature of "high energy and low frequency" was lower than that of "low energy and high frequency" (P<0.05). When the power was 10 W and the minimum irrigation rate was 10 mL/min,the plateau temperature did not reach the safety threshold (43 ℃). When the power was 20 W and the minimum irrigation rate was 10 mL/min,the platform temperature exceeded the safety threshold. When the irrigation rate was 20 mL/min,the platform temperature did not reach the safety threshold. 【Conclusion】 In the study of ureteral lithotripsy in vitro,the power,mode,irrigation rate and optical fiber diameter are factors affecting the thermal effects of TFL. No matter what kind of lithotripsy mode and fiber diameter,the temperature around the fiber is safe when the lithotripsy power is ≤10 W and the irrigation rate is ≥10 mL/min;when the lithotripsy power is ≤20 W and the irrigation rate is ≥20 mL/min,the temperature around the fiber is safe.

【Objective】 To investigate the efficacy of low intensity pulsed ultrasound (LIPUS) in the treatment of erectile dysfunction (ED). 【Methods】 A total of 121 ED patients treated during June 2020 and June 2022 were selected as the research objects. According to the International Erectile Index Score (IIEF-EF), the patients were divided into three subgroups:mild (17-25 points), moderate (11-16 points), and severe (0-10 points). The total effective rate, erectile hardness scale (EHS), sex life log questions (SEP), general assessment questionnaire (GAQ), peak systolic velocity (PSV), end diastolic velocity (EDV), and adverse reactions of the three groups before treatment, 4 weeks and 12 weeks after treatment were analyzed. 【Results】 A total of 119 patients completed the follow-up. There were significant increases in IIEF-EF and EHS at week 4 and 12 (P<0.05), and the total effective rate was 69.75% and 76.47%, respectively. The total effective rate was significantly higher in the mild and moderate groups than in the severe group at week 4 and 12 (P<0.05). The patients who answered "yes" to SEP2 and SEP3 accounted for 91.60% and 71.43%, respectively at week 4, and 92.44% and 78.15% at week 12, both significantly higher than the rates before treatment (52.10% and 27.73%, P<0.05). The proportion of patients who answered "yes" to GAQl and GAQ2 at week 4 were 84.87% and 71.43%, respectively, and were 82.35% and 70.59% respectively at week 12, with no significant difference. The PSV level significantly increased at week 12 compared to that before treatment [(48.85±14.11) cm/s vs. (41.42±14.90) cm/s] (P<0.05), while the EDV level significantly decreased [(-0.57±7.01) cm/s vs. (2.25± 5.68)cm/s] (P<0.05). 【Conclusion】 LIPUS can improve erectile function in ED patients without obvious adverse reactions.

【Objective】 To compare the efficacy of radiofrequency thermocoagulation and pulsed radiofrequency for the ganglion impar in treating primary perineal pain. 【Methods】 We analyzed 79 patients with primary perineal pain who underwent radiofrequency thermocoagulation (group A) and pulsed radiofrequency (group B) in the ganglion impar from January 2020 to March 2022. VAS, excellent and good rates, sleep quality, postoperative medication usage, complications, and recurrence were evaluated before and 24 h, 1 W, 1 M, 3 M and 6 M after operation. The differences between the two groups were compared. 【Results】 The VAS score of group A gradually decreased at each level after operation, and the VAS score of group B gradually increased after 24 hours of operation. The differences between the two groups began to appear 1 week after operation, and the differences further increased with the extension of time (P<0.001). In six months after follow-up, the excellent and good rates of group A (86%) was significantly higher than that of group B (22%). In addition to postoperative perineal skin numbness, group A was superior to group B in improving sleep, postoperative oral medication (pregabalin and opioids), and disease recurrence (P<0.05). 【Conclusion】 Radiofrequency thermocoagulation for the ganglion impar can improve the quality of life by reducing pain, improving the excellent and good rates, improving sleep, and reducing recurrence a medication. The effect is better than that of pulsed radiofrequency.

AIM:To explore the efficacy of intense pulsed light combined with meibomian gland massage and diquafosol eye drops in lipid deficiency dry eye disease and related cytokines.METHODS: A total of 511 patients(1 022 eyes)with lipid deficiency dry eye diagnosed in the ophthalmology clinic of our hospital from January to December 2021 were selected as the research objects. They were divided into two groups according to the patient's wishes: 294 cases(588 eyes)in the study group were treated with diquafosol sodium eye drops combined with intense pulsed light and meibomian gland massage, while 217 cases(434 eyes)in the control group were treated with artificial tears combined with intense pulsed light and meibomian gland massage. The levels of tear tumor necrosis factor-α(TNF-α), interleukin-1β(IL-1β)and lactoferrin(LF)before and after treatment were detected, the corneal fluorescein staining(CFS)score, tear film break-up time(BUT), and Schirmer Ⅰ(SⅠt)under no surface anesthesia, ocular surface disease index(OSDI)were compared, the correlation between TNF-α, IL-1β, LF levels and CFS, BUT, SⅠt, OSDI before treatment was analyzed, and the occurrence of adverse reactions was observed.RESULTS: There was no significant difference in preoperative OSDI, SⅠt, BUT, CFS and levels of TNF-α, IL-1β and LF between the two groups(P&#x003E;0.05). The SⅠt, BUT, CFS and levels of TNF-α, IL-1β and LF in the study group at 3, 6 and 9wk after treatment were better than those of control group(P&#x003C;0.05). There were no differences in OSDI score of both groups at 9wk after treatment(P&#x003E;0.05). The TNF-α and IL-1β were negatively correlated with SⅠt and BUT, while they were positively correlated with CFS and OSDI; LF and SⅠt were positively correlated with SⅠt and BUT, while they were negatively correlated with CFS and OSDI(all P&#x003C;0.01); The adverse reaction rate of the study group(5.78%)was significantly lower than that of the control group(11.52%; P&#x003C;0.05).CONCLUSION: Intense pulsed light combined with meibomian gland massage and diquafosol sodium eye drops is effective and well tolerated in the treatment of lipid deficiency dry eye.

AIM: To investigate the efficacy and safety of frequency of intense pulsed light(IPL)in the treatment of meibomian gland dysfunction.METHODS: In this retrospective study, a total of 108 patients(216 eyes)with meibomian gland dysfunction admitted to our hospital from January 2021 to June 2022 were included. They were divided into two groups, with 54 cases(108 eyes)IPL group(energy density 13.0J/cm2, pulse width 6ms, delay time 50ms), and 54 cases(108 eyes)in advanced optimal pulsed technology(AOPT)group(energy density 10.0-16.0J/cm2, pulse width 7-4-4 ms in unequal-division mode). The clinical effects of the two groups were observed and compared, including ocular surface symptoms, corneal fluorescein staining score(FL), tear film lipid layer thickness(LLT), ocular surface disease index(OSDI)score, mean non-invasive tear film break-up time(NIBUTav)and first non-invasive tear film break-up time(NIBUTf), tear meniscus height, score of meibomian gland secretion and its secretion traits, and the incidence of adverse effects was also calculated.RESULTS: The effective rate of the AOPT group(106 eyes, 98.1%)was higher than that of the IPL group(90 eyes, 83.3%, P&#x003C;0.05), as well as OSDI score, FL score, score of meibomian gland secretion and its secretion traits, LLT NIBUTav, NIBUTf and tear meniscus height(all P&#x003C;0.001). However, the incidence of adverse effects of the AOPT group(18 eyes, 16.7%)was higher than that of the IPL group(4 eyes, 3.7%; P&#x003C;0.05).CONCLUSION: With significant improvement in the ocular surface symptoms and function, AOPT has a better therapeutic effect on the treatment of meibomian gland dysfunction, but it has more adverse reactions. Therefore, optimal treatment plan should be fully selected in combination with the actual clinical situation.

@#Abstract: Objective In order to provide reference for emergency treatment of a sudden food poisoning incident, pathogen detection and drug resistance analysis were carried out. Methods Diarrheal stool and surplus food samples were detected by GB 4789 and the isolates were identified by VITEK2 and matrix assisted laser desorption ionization-time of flight mass spectrometry (MALDI-TOF MS), at the same time, the bacterial drug sensitivity test was carried out by using the method of microbroth dilution, and the isolates from different sources were molecularly classified by pulsed field gel electrophoresis (PFGE), and the correlation between the strains was analyzed by BioNumerics software. Results Totaly 13 leftovers and 3 diarrhea patients were isolated and identified, The total number of colonies and coliforms in 7 leftovers samples all exceeded the standard, and Citrobacter freundii was detected in 5 leftovers and 2 stools. The results of drug sensitivity test showed that seven strains of Citrobacter freundii were sensitive to ciprofloxacin, tetracycline, chloramphenicol, gentamicin, amikacin, cefotaxime and meropenem, but completely resistant to ampicillin, and there was no multiple drug resistance. The results of pulsed field gel electrophoresis (PFGE) showed that 7 strains of Citrobacter freundii had the same PFGE bands and 100% homology, showing the same clone. Conclusions This food poisoning incident was caused by Citrobacter freundii. The pathogen of food poisoning can be quickly and accurately determined by MALDI-TOF MS, which is beneficial to the early diagnosis and treatment of infectious diseases. It is suggested to strengthen the corresponding management, improve food safety awareness and prevent similar incidents.

Background The incidence of Legionnaires' disease is increasing globally and artificial water environment is becoming a common source of outbreaks. Molecular typing techniques can help prevent and control Legionella. Objective To understand the molecular epidemiological characteristics of Legionella pneumophila in artificial water environment of Shanghai hospitals, and provide a scientific basis for the prevention and control of Legionnaires' disease. Methods Water samples were collected from artificial water environment in 14 hospitals from May to October each year from 2019 to 2020 in Shanghai. A total of 984 water samples were collected from 8 Grade-A tertiary hospitals and 6 non-Grade-A tertiary hospitals, including 312 samples of cooling water, 72 samples of chilled water, and 600 samples of tap water. The water samples were isolated and serotyped for Legionella pneumophila and preserved, and the positive rate of Legionella pneumophila in the samples was used as an indicator of contamination. The preserved strains were resuscitated and 81 surviving strains were obtained for pulsed field gel electrophoresis (PFGE) typing analysis. Results A total of 124 Legionella pneumophila positive water samples were detected, with a positive rate of 12.60%. The positive rate was higher in the Grade-A tertiary hospitals (16.54%, 87/526) than in the non-Grade-A tertiary hospitals (8.08%, 37/458) (χ2=15.91, P<0.001). The positive rate of cooling water (23.40%) was the highest among different types of water samples, and the difference was statistically significant (χ2=61.19, P<0.001). The difference in positive rate of tap water was statistically significant among different hospital departments (χ2=11.37, P<0.05). The positive rate in 2019 (15.06%) was higher than that in 2020 (9.84%) (χ2=6.23, P<0.05). From May to October, August had the highest annual average positive rate (16.46%) and October had the lowest (8.54%), but the difference in positive rates among months was not statistically significant (χ2=5.39, P=0.37). The difference in positive rate among districts was statistically significant (χ2=24.88, P<0.001). A total of 131 strains of Legionella pneumophila were isolated, with serotype 1 (80.15%, 105/131) predominating. Among the 81 surviving strains of Legionella pneumophila subjected to PFGE typing, the band-based similarity coefficients ranged from 41.30% to 100%. Among the 29 PFGE band types (S1-S29) recorded, each band type included 1-10 strains, and S28 was the dominant band type. Four clusters (I-IV) of PFGE band types were identified, accounting for 66.67% (54/81) of all strains and containing 13 band types. Conclusion Legionella pneumophila contamination is present in the artificial water environment of hospitals in Shanghai from 2019 to 2020, and the contamination in tap water deserves attention. The detected serotype of Legionella pneumophila is predominantly type 1, and PFGE typing reveals the presence of genetic polymorphism. Therefore, the monitoring and control of Legionella pneumophila in hospital artificial water environment should be strengthened.

Objective To investigate the etiological characteristics of food poisoning isolates of Vibrio parahaemolyticus (VP) from 2019 to 2021 in Zhongshan City. Methods A total of 37 strains of Vibrio parahaemolyticus isolated from 8 food poisoning incidents in Zhongshan City from 2019 to 2021 were collected, including 1 residual food isolate and 36 human isolates. The genetic correlation of Vibrio parahaemolyticus food poisoning isolates in this region was analyzed by serological typing, virulence gene detection (TLH, TDH, and TRH), drug sensitivity test, pulsed field gel electrophoresis (PFGE) and multipoint sequence typing (MLST). Results The 37 strains of Vibrio parahaemolyticus were divided into 4 serotypes: O3:K6, O10:K4, O4:K8, and O4:KUT. The tdh+ and trh- were the main virulence genotypes, accounting for 97.30% (36/37). The drug resistance rate of cefazolin was 40.54% (15 strains R, 22 strains I), and no multidrug-resistant strains were found. The 37 VP strains were divided into 23 PFGE types and 6 cluster groups, with correlation coefficients ranging from 60.4%-100%. The multipoint sequencing typing showed that the 37 VP strains were divided into 9 ST types and 3 complex groups, of which ST3 type was the main type (23 strains, 62.1%). Conclusion This study has found that the dominant virulence types of Vibrio parahaemolyticus food poisoning isolates in Zhongshan City from 2019 to 2021 are tdh+ and trh-, and 37 representative strains can be divided into 6 PFGE clusters and 9 ST types with MLST type being mainly ST3. This study has identified the rare serotype O10:K4 which has caused an increase in the proportion of food poisoning events, suggesting that we should strengthen detection and be alert to the risk of continued local epidemics of new rare serotype strains.

AIM: To investigate the safety and efficacy of intense pulsed light in the treatment of severe chronic ocular graft-versus-host disease.METHODS: Prospective randomized controlled study. A total of 35 cases(35 eyes), who had a history of allogenic hematopoietic stem cell transplantation(allo-HSCT), admitted to the Affiliated Hospital of Xuzhou Medical University from January to September 2022 and were diagnosed by our hospital's hematology and ophthalmology departments with severe chronic ocular graft-versus-host disease(coGVHD)were selected. One eye was randomly selected for inclusion in the study if both eyes met the enrollment criteria, and the eye was selected if a single eye met the enrollment criteria. All patients were administrated with Dextran and Hypromellose eye drops 4 times a day and Cyclosporine eye drops twice a day. The experimental group was additionally treated with intense pulsed light, once every two weeks a week, for 4 times in total. The evaluation indicators were evaluated before treatment and 2wk, 1 and 2mo after treatment. The evaluation indicators include ocular surface disease index(OSDI)score, best corrected visual acuity(BCVA), intraocular pressure(IOP), tear meniscus height(TMH), non-invasive break-up time(NIBUT), conjunctival injection score(CIS), meibomian gland area proportion(MGAP), meibomian gland evaluation(MGE), cornea fluorescein staining(CFS), conjunctival lissamine green staining(CLGS), lid margin abnormality score(LMAS), and Schirmer's Ⅰ test(SⅠt).RESULTS: After treatment, OSDI score, TMH, NIBUT, BCVA, CFS, CLGS, and CIS improved in both groups compared with those before treatment(all P&#x003C;0.05), with NIBUT, CFS and CLGS showing more significant improvements in the test group. In the control group, MGAP, MGE of the upper and lower eyelids and LMAS did not change significantly before and after treatment(P&#x003E;0.05), while in the experimental group, MGAP of the lower eyelids, MGE of upper and lower eyelids and LMAS improved compared with those before treatment(P&#x003C;0.05), except for MGAP of the upper eyelids, which did not differ from that before treatment(P&#x003E;0.05). There was no difference in SⅠt and IOP between the two groups before and after treatment(P&#x003E;0.05). Patients did not experience adverse reactions such as skin burns, redness and swelling in the treated area and eyelash loss during the follow-up period.CONCLUSION: Intense pulsed light is safe and effective in the treatment of severe coGVHD, which can significantly improve the symptoms and signs of patients and enhance the stability of tear film.

The study aims to explore the effect of mesenchymal stem cells-derived exosomes (MSCs-Exo) on staurosporine (STS)-induced chondrocyte apoptosis before and after exposure to pulsed electromagnetic field (PEMF) at different frequencies. The AMSCs were extracted from the epididymal fat of healthy rats before and after exposure to the PEMF at 1 mT amplitude and a frequency of 15, 45, and 75 Hz, respectively, in an incubator. MSCs-Exo was extracted and identified. Exosomes were labeled with DiO fluorescent dye, and then co-cultured with STS-induced chondrocytes for 24 h. Cellular uptake of MSC-Exo, apoptosis, and the protein and mRNA expression of aggrecan, caspase-3 and collagenⅡA in chondrocytes were observed. The study demonstrated that the exposure of 75 Hz PEMF was superior to 15 and 45 Hz PEMF in enhancing the effect of exosomes in alleviating chondrocyte apoptosis and promoting cell matrix synthesis. This study lays a foundation for the regulatory mechanism of PEMF stimulation on MSCs-Exo in inhibiting chondrocyte apoptosis, and opens up a new direction for the prevention and treatment of osteoarthritis.
